What is the main defense strategy in Sammy Schaefer's murder trial?
In Sammy Schaefer's murder trial, the defense's key strategy is challenging the credibility of Marty Shaw, who is the primary witness providing the narrative that prosecutors are relying on. During pretrial hearings, the defense argued it's unfair to trust Shaw's account since he is the man Schaefer allegedly hired for the murder and is also facing murder charges himself. This credibility challenge represents a major strategic approach for the defense team as they attempt to undermine the prosecution's case by questioning the reliability of testimony coming from someone with significant legal jeopardy of his own. The defense hopes to create reasonable doubt by highlighting Shaw's potential motivation to shift blame.

All 80 passengers and crew aboard Delta Flight 4819 miraculously survived the crash landing at Toronto's Pearson Airport despite the aircraft flipping upside down. The heroic four-member flight crew played a crucial role, standing on the ceiling of the inverted plane to help passengers escape from their seatbelt restraints. First responders arrived quickly at the scene, providing immediate assistance to the 21 injured individuals who suffered back sprains, head injuries, headaches and nausea. Their rapid response, combined with the flight crew's actions, ensured everyone made it out alive from what could have been a catastrophic incident, earning both groups recognition as heroes for their life-saving efforts.
